Spiritual Pathways 8-week Small Group Studies

These courses of study will lead us to deeper understanding in a small group setting, where we are known, cared for, and supported in our faith journey. Each of the Pathways is Biblically based and is a key Christian topic that will give a broader understanding of our faith. Each course will rotate through the Sunday morning classes, so you may stay with one caring group or join a new class for another session.

The six Books & Pathways, which rotate through all classes are:

  1. “An Altar in the World”: Pathway of Creativity
  2. "Luke": Pathway of Scripture
  3. "To Do Justice": Pathway of Service
  4. "What do our Neighbors Believe": Pathway of Tradition
  5. "What's the Least I can Believe and Still be a Christian?": Pathway of Theological Reflection
  6. "When Christians get it Wrong": Pathway of Community
